4/28/10…..WEDNESDAY

WOD

USING DUMBELLS 53#/35# DO 5 ROUNDS OF:

4 LUNGE STEPS/7 CLEANS

4 LUNGE STEPS/7 FRONT SQUATS

4 LUNGE STEPS/7 PUSH PRESS

4 LUNGE STEPS/7 SPLIT JERKS

“YOU FOUND YOURSELF AT UTC”

In this plush, overfed part of the world that we live in, CrossFit strips us to the bone and lets us see the very marrow of our souls. And what lies there, inside of us, is not always pretty. Sometimes it is a bitter heart, or a quitter’s attitude, or a cheater’s nature.  It is raw and revealed and naked. But it is us. It is who we are, who we were, and, most importantly, who we will be if we do not work harder. In that realization of our own inadequacies, however, lies our very salvation. For, within the confines of the Workout of the Day, if we’re lucky, in that moment of dedication and drive, in that frenzy of encouragement, support, and love for our fellow CrossFitters, we also catch a glimpse of our very best selves – and, if we’re observant, we see it in others too. Through our CrossFitting efforts, we see who we could become, with a little more effort, a little more honesty, and a little more courage.  Just like a faster 5K time, that better self is within our grasp; if we try hard enough, if we do the work, if we believe. Try. Work. Believe.
